The technical aspects of SEO come into play as well. Things like website speed, mobile-friendliness, and site structure are all factors that influence rankings. Then there’s the content itself. Quality content that is well-written, informative, and engaging is key. But, even the best content can be buried if it’s not optimized correctly. Moreover, the link building, also called backlink, is very important. Backlinks are like votes of confidence from other websites. The more high-quality backlinks you have, the more authoritative your website appears to Google and other search engines. This is the key of SEO, to become an authority in the field.
